What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Weekend Registered Behavior Technician (RBT), and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end RBT, you need a solid understanding of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) principles, a high school diploma or equivalent, and the RBT certification from the Behavior Analyst Certification Board (BACB). Familiarity with data collection tools, ABA software, and experience following treatment plans is essential. Strong communication, patience, and adaptability make someone stand out when working directly with clients and their families.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ering consistent, effective behavioral interventions and supporting client progress during weekend sessions.

What is a Weekend RBT?

A Weekend RBT (Registered Behavior Technician) is a certified paraprofessional who works under the supervision of a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) to provide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) therapy, typically on weekends. Their primary role is to implement behavior intervention plans and teach skills to individuals with autism or other developmental disorders. Weekend RBTs may work in clients' homes, clinics, or community settings, providing flexible support outside of traditional weekday hours.

Responsibilities
  • Use creativity to teach individuals with disabilities
  • Language Development with non-verbal individuals
  • Provide direct behavioral services to clients in individual and group sessions
  • Run skill acquisition programs with clients using Applied Behavior Analysis and Verbal Behavior Analysis
  • Complete weekly program writing and maintain clients program book
  • Work with Board Certified Behavior Analysts and/or Board Certified Assistant Behavior Analysts to implement individualized treatment plans
  • Collect data and graph data as instructed using technological programs, such as Catalyst and/or any other software utilized by the company once trained.
  • Maintain respect and confidentiality for all clients
  • Maintain profess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ops; reviewing professional publications; establishing personal networks; participating in professional societies
  • Maintain and protect the well-being of all clients during treatment sessions and when emergency crisis situations arise
